Nationals 2, Reds 1

WASHINGTON (AP) — Matt Wieters homered, Tanner Roark went seven innings to win his third straight start and the Washington Nationals defeated the Reds 2-1.

The Nationals took three of four from the Reds and have won eight of 11 overall.

Roark (6-12) allowed a run on seven singles. He got a nice ovation when he made a diving stop on Billy Hamilton’s comeback to end the seventh.

In his last three outings, Roark has allowed two earned runs in 22 innings (0.82 ERA) with 20 strikeouts and a walk.
